Viacom loses YouTube copyright lawsuit - again

Friday, April 19, 2013 - 12:22 in Mathematics & Economics

For the second time in three years, a U.S. federal judge has dismissed Viacom's $1 billion US copyright lawsuit against YouTube, saying the online video site doesn't have to police itself as long as it removes infringing videos when copyright owners give notice.
